The Basement Water Damage Restoration Process: What You Can Expect
At our company, we believe that a proper process is key to a successful restoration. That’s why we’ve developed a meticulous step-by-step approach to ensure your basement is restored to its original condition. Our technicians will work tirelessly to:
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Identify the source of the water and find out the extent of the damage. Our team will create a personalized plan to address your unique needs.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Use advanced equipment to extract water from your basement, including powerful pumps and wet vacuums.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Employ specialized drying techniques to remove moisture from your basement, including the use of industrial-strength dehumidifiers.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
Use antimicrobial treatments to remove bacteria, mold, and mildew that can pose health risks.
Step 5: Repair and Reconstruction
Restore your basement to its original condition by repairing or replacing damaged materials, such as drywall, flooring, and insulation.

Basement Water Damage Restoration Cost in Elk Plain, WA
The cost of Basement Water Damage Restoration can vary greatly dep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Elk Plain, WA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of water damage |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Type of contaminants, size of affected area |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$1,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of repairs needed |
| Equipment Rental and Labor |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Antimicrobial Treatment | $100 – $500 | Type of contaminants, size of affected area |
| Final Inspection and Certification | $100 – $300 | Size of affected area, type of inspection needed |
